Hi comrades ive just popped over from fabia forum, I am thinking of going for either a L&K or Elegance model,however I am looking at the Volvo V70 but I have always prefered the Octavia as I really miss my old GLXi estate, so in eassence is the L&K spec worth the extra dosh?emoticon-0148-yes.gif

I have had mine for over a year, and love it.

Depending on what driving you do, mine is a DSG, with Alcantara, and Bluetooth (plus a couple of extras)

When I looked at spec'ing up the elegance, it turned out cheaper to buy the L&K,

the xenon's are amazing. Heated seats coming into the winter are fab, and so are the electric seats.

there are a number of other features, but to be honest I cant remember what they are, but defo worth the extra.

Good luck.

One of the many reasons I went for the 1.8 TSI DSG L&K.

The VRS does have stiffer suspension which is more suited when going bananas but the comfort, toys and with the 7 speed DSG which helps give 100 km further range but still only half a second slower to 62 mph. We have a TSI VRS as well which I drove for 10K but done nearly 40K in a year in the L&K and it is the nicer place to be with the electric and heated seats, adaptive lighting, Alacantara, the list is long.

The 7 speed DSG will take up to 380 Nm some tuning houses reckon but since the standard max power come in at 4500 ie 2500 short of the red line then keeping the torque at 250-300 Nm and letting the revs rise should let power rise to 215 hp and I recall seeing this quoted by some tuning houses.

Probably will not do this to my Octavia but will do it for the Superb I replace it for in the next 6 months or so. But you cannot get an L&K package for the 1.8TSI strangely enough so I will have to spec and S/SE/SE Plus and add some further bits unless they add the excellent 1.8TSI to the L&K listing.

Want we want to see is the Audi VVT version of the 1.8 TSI that puts out more torque than the TSI VRS ie 320 NM from 1400-3700 rpm, crikey!!!!!!!

Octaiva L&K is excellent. I am on my second. First for 4 years, current for 2. Silver, black Alcantara, 2.0 TDI DSG with flappy paddles, xenon lights taht look round the bend. it is a great car. Practical beyond anything I have ever driven - glovebox, coin holder, sunglasses holder, space for maps, books, water bottles, HUGE BOOT that fits two sets of golf clubs, shoes, electric trolleys and weekend bags.

What extra would I like on it? vRS engine and brakes. 4x4 with the DSG. electric handbrake like the Passat. Stop/start technology. Satnav that does not require a remortgage to update, and can be taken out, or a space to put a satnav with a sensible power supply (perhaps a usb slot). Oh, and tyres that automatically switch to winter tyres when the temperature drops below 8 degrees.
